I need to enable cr4 bit 8 (PCE) on all cores of a given system. I currently have a working module which sets this bit on the core it runs on when the module is loaded. I am stuck here and haven't found much documentation on how to parallelize this to run on all cores:
1) It appears that the unload doesn't always happen on the core the load happened on, so I can't clean up correctly
2) I can't figure out any way to force the module initialization to be executed on a particular core - if I could, I could simply have have a module can be called separately for each core to set all cores. There doesn't seem to be a sched_setaffinity equivalent available for modules.
Is there any way to force this module to run on all cores, either through parallelization or iterating across all cores? I can't modify the kernel itself or make the module load at boot, so I can't just change what the register is initially set to.

Figured it out - smp_call_function() calls a function on all cores of the system. It's just very tricky to get a search result that brings this up (little / no documentation) :-/
This works perfectly, and you can verify each core runs the code by printing smp_processor_id() within the called function.
EDIT: This function only calls other cores, so you still have to call the function once separately to get the core the module is currently running on!
